    JOB DESCRIPTION SUMMARY
    The Director of Innovation & Entrepreneurship Programs will have primary responsibility for co-curricular programs designed to engage students from across WPI in innovation and entrepreneurship. The Director will have primary responsibility for co-curricular programming, playing a pivotal role in supporting student innovators and entrepreneurs and driving the success of student-centric startups. This role requires a visionary leader with a strong business acumen, excellent interpersonal skills, and a passion for nurturing and supporting students in their educational journeys.

    JOB DESCRIPTION
    Responsibilities:



    • Develop and execute a comprehensive strategy for engaging undergraduate students in I&E.

    • Serve as Director for the I&E center working to ensure that it remains at the forefront of industry trends and innovations that benefit student innovators and student entrepreneurs.

    • Work in partnership with the Office of Technology Innovation and Entrepreneurship on supporting the start-up incubation and acceleration strategy at WPI.

    • Establish key performance indicators to measure the success and impact of I&E programs, emphasizing student outcomes and impact on all WPI students.

    • Develop co-curricular programs to encourage student innovation and entrepreneurship at WPI, including ongoing evaluation of existing programming to determine initiatives for continuation.

    • Facilitate networking events, workshops, and knowledge-sharing sessions to foster a sense of community and collaboration among student innovators and entrepreneurs.

    • Oversee Gift Awards and competitions to support the launch of student-led innovation and startups.

    • Establish and maintain a marketing program for the I&E Center, which includes but not limited to website upkeep and social media outreach.

    • Cultivate a collaborative and supportive community across campus in coordination with space and facilities manager/committees, prioritizing the needs and development of student innovators and student entrepreneurs.

    • Coordinate Entrepreneurs in Residence, matching them with student entrepreneurs and monitoring their effectiveness.

    • Provide outreach to community-based Entrepreneurial Support Organizations, including entrepreneurship programs at Worcester-based universities and colleges to secure resources and support for student-led startups and student-facing I&E initiatives.

    • Collaborate with alumni, industry experts, mentors, and advisors to create a robust network that adds value to student innovations and startups.

    • Manage the allocation of resources, including student employees hired to support the I&E activities.

    • Work closely with the Division of University Advancement to secure additional resources and opportunities for student participants in I&E.

    • Assist students in identifying and applying for grants, competitions, and other funding sources.

    • Monitor the progress of student startups within the I&E Center, providing guidance and intervention as needed.

    • Regularly assess the success and impact of the incubator's programs, making data-driven decisions to continuously improve student outcomes.

    • Collect and analyze feedback from student participants to refine and enhance I&E programming.

    • Develop educational workshops, seminars, and training sessions for both online and classroom environments tailored to the needs of student innovators and entrepreneurs.

    • Teach innovation and entrepreneurship classes within the Business School.

    • Support PQP/IQP/MQPs programs for student startups

    • Support International House with OPT (optional practical training) initiatives as relevant




    Requirements:



    • Bachelor's degree in business, entrepreneurship, or a related field (Master's degree preferred) and 4 years of experience.

    • Proven experience in business incubation, startup acceleration, or entrepreneurial support programs within a university ecosystem.

    • Strong leadership and management skills with a track record of success in a similar role.

    •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ills to build and maintain relationships with diverse community members and especially students.

    • Demonstrated ability to think strategically and drive innovation.

    • Knowledge of funding mechanisms, investment processes, and business development.

    • Experience with fundraising.

    • Passion for working with students and a commitment to supporting their entrepreneurial journey in an environment that embraces DEIB.




    Salary: $82,600 - $100,000. WPI's benefits package includes a robust retirement match, wellness perks, tuition assistance and more!
